如何使用Windows命令行执行orientdb脚本。 例如我一直在尝试 << console.bat script.osql>> 但我需要一个命令来从Windows命令行执行它与用户名和密码。我知道通常在mysql中有一种方法可以从命令行执行.sql文件。在orientdb有任何类似的方式吗? 我是对orientdb.appriciate任何帮助的新手 感谢名单。
答案 0 :(得分:2)
我认为script.osql文件包含一堆SQL脚本,而您正在尝试执行批处理脚本?
如果是这样,您可以将登录信息包含在与另一个SQL脚本相同的文件中,并完成工作。
以下是一个示例脚本(比如script.osql),
connect remote:localhost/Test2 admin admin;
CREATE CLASS B;
CREATE PROPERTY B.name STRING;
CREATE CLASS A;
CREATE PROPERTY A.name STRING;
ALTER PROPERTY A.name MANDATORY true;
CREATE PROPERTY A.bList LINKSET B;
您可以使用console.bat执行上述批处理脚本。命令类似于下面的内容;
console.bat script.osql
希望这有帮助。